2015-07-07 2 views
5

Я хотел бы очертить мою коллекцию на основе диапазона на осколках mongodb, мой вопрос в том, является ли осколочный ключ строковым полем, тогда как мы разделим строковый ключ на основе строки в разных кусках для очертания диапазона на основе? ?Mongodb Range Based sharding

ответ

0

Вы можете разделить строку на черепах, используя ярлык, соответствующий знаку. Вы создаете «теги», обозначающие диапазоны ключа для назначения определенному осколку. Балансировщик Mongo будет обрабатывать распределение данных, и когда вы напишете запрос для данного ключа, Монго будет знать, что он нацелен только на этот осколок.

Для получения дополнительной информации см. Следующий URL-адрес от поставщика. sharding-introduction/

+0

Я знаю, что о знаке, о котором идет речь, но если мне нужно использовать разметку с учетом знака, тогда почему существует одинарная разметка на основе диапазона или дальность базы данных только для числовых типов ??? –

 Смежные вопросы

  • Нет связанных вопросов^_^